The responsibility of the writer

The responsibility of the writer

Literature, which integrates with nature and life, competes with time and carries time from yesterday to tomorrow.

The writer transcends time by showing the selected, distilled, aestheticized form of the life adventure, the holistic reality based on a reality.

This transfer involves the search for better lives.

Literature, which continues with a search, tries to open the curtains of humanity's yesterday and paves the way for the sparkles of tomorrow.

The method of approaching all works of our great critic Fethi Naci , who said that “the job of literature is not only about aesthetic function but also has a social moral aspect”, was “concerned about reflecting our age accurately” .

THE WORLD TODAY

We learn the past and present of life best from literature.

Literature has such a noble mission.

What does literature, which is charged with this task, see in today's world and how will it convey today's world to future times?

The picture we see in today's world is a frightening and hurtful one.

In the first half of the 20th century, we experienced two major world wars. The destruction, burning, killing, death camps, atomic bombs of these wars must not have been enough because in recent history, we have always experienced pain and destruction in the world. In the second half of the 20th century and in the 21st century, we experienced wars, we are experiencing them, and we have observed and are observing that the world has been turned into bomb fields.

We live in a polluted world. This is a world that has become a garbage dump, with its soil, mountains, plains, seas, skies, rivers, lakes, buildings, and streets polluted. People are also in this garbage dump and are polluted with their emotions, thoughts, dreams, and beliefs.

In a world where everything is consumed, where everything is bought and sold, where the value of everything is measured with money, where the market and money have been made the highest value, we see that values, culture, art, love, and affection are all consumed.

Seeing a life consumed with fanaticism, barbarity, blood, savagery, aggression, tyranny, massacres, wars and everything else added to these breaks the hearts of literary people and confuses them as well.

WRITING TODAY'S WORLD

The man of letters thinks: Can humanity, which maintains its civilization on blood, beautify the world with its hypocrisy?

When we look at the world today, where our lives are not filled with heartwarming images and consumption and war, we see that this shows the literary man how great the difficulties he has to overcome are and he answers “No” .

The frightening reality we are faced with is, unfortunately, knocking on our door as a legacy that humanity has brought from yesterday.

This reality also shows that, as the Native American proverb says, the future we borrow from our children is darkened.

The sadness that comes to a man of letters when he sees humanity bombing the foundations of its own existence is terrible, and humanity did not deserve it. This bleeding reality that we are faced with centuries after a war that became epic in the Iliad is shameful.

A man of letters does not want to live with this shame. He wants to prevent war from being inevitable and the fate of humanity. This is the task that time has given to a man of letters. It is the most necessary duty imposed by life to contribute to the eradication of wars from the world with his most valuable weapon, literature.

The literary man must fulfill the duty that time has imposed on him by coming to terms with the bad lives of the past, by bravely revealing the mistakes of the present, and by being the caller of the search for a tomorrow purified from ugliness.

***

As a writer, in addition to my novels, the books I wrote to ease the burden of this difficult task, such as Nazi Camps, Forgetting Sivas, Umut İnsanda, 68 Generation, War and Literature, and my biography studies, are the products of my literary responsibility.
